# The 5 Pillars of Application Security Today

Did you know that application security is more than just writing secure code?

Many modern applications comprise source code, third-party dependencies, container images, cloud infrastructure, and CI/CD pipelines. Let's explore all 5 of them 👇.

---

![](https://cdn.hashnode.com/res/hashnode/image/upload/v1705252712203/11178225-a01b-44e3-af7e-3fa33e8d9356.png align="center")

---

![](https://cdn.hashnode.com/res/hashnode/image/upload/v1705252725864/02c83780-bc29-4bc5-a92a-f824de598106.png align="center")

---

![](https://cdn.hashnode.com/res/hashnode/image/upload/v1705252740291/92134031-867f-4390-bab7-86d32bd1c218.png align="center")

---

![](https://cdn.hashnode.com/res/hashnode/image/upload/v1705252759597/9c258ab5-0ec7-40fb-ab84-60c439ff0aaa.png align="center")

---

![](https://cdn.hashnode.com/res/hashnode/image/upload/v1705252772388/4433a16b-f245-4eb9-83c5-b1132cd53c70.png align="center")

---

![](https://cdn.hashnode.com/res/hashnode/image/upload/v1705252785409/b27ae9bc-0202-4a58-b633-7c4e693d1486.png align="center")
